All events your plugin emits must have a schema registered in the Lanternwick registry before they will be accepted by the Corvel event bus. Submit schemas in the Avric IDL format, versioned with strict backward compatibility; the registry rejects breaking changes automatically. Test submissions go to the staging registry first, and promotion requires a green compatibility report. Every schema upload must be signed so we can trace provenance, and for that you will use the deploy key below.

deploy key for kajof-yawif: bky9_fvxrpdHPq

Ticket: Digest scheduler stuck in staging

New folks: the Mailloom batch digest service on the Verastack staging box was misconfigured after last week's redeploy. DIGEST_CRON was set to the production cadence and DIGEST_BATCH_SIZE was missing entirely, so digests queued but never sent. Fix both per the staging defaults in the team wiki. After correcting those, the service still needs its delivery credential, so append the following line to the env file.

vault entry, kafog-yahop: COURIER_KEY8=0faa53ae

Since last night's rotation, the Lotwall parking-garage occupancy feed from the Brindleton deck has been rejected by our ingest gateway with SIG_MISMATCH. The publisher at Kervane Mobility re-signed their payloads, but our verifier still holds the retired key. Nothing is wrong with the feed itself — counts are accurate when verification is bypassed in staging. Please update the trusted keyring on ingest-02 before re-enabling strict mode. For reference during review, the current signing key is:

deploy key for kajof-fajop: bky6_gDHw9Q

## Dependency Pinning Policy — Orchat Plugin Platform

All plugins published to the Orchat registry must pin direct dependencies to exact versions; ranges and wildcards are rejected at submission. Transitive dependencies are resolved once at build time and frozen into the lockfile, which becomes part of the provenance record. Each accepted build is reproducible from its lockfile alone and is identified by the provenance token below.

pipeline stamp: htk9_ce63042d9